-
У криптанов случился очередной скандал – с блэкджеком и этими самыми, о ком вы подумали: платформа Celsius закрысила $12 миллиардов, и никак не может понять – соскамилась она уже полностью, или пока только чуть-чуть. Разбираемся, что произошло, и какие выводы…
-
Google запустил тренажёр для подготовки к собеседованиям Interview Warmup
Бьюсь об заклад, вы не раз испытывали стресс перед важным интервью. Волнение на собеседовании — это совершенно нормально. Однако, если вы знаете, что тревожность — ваша слабая сторона, а ответственный разговор сопровождается трясущимися руками и спутанными мыслями, у меня для…
-
Химия вместо гадания: перекись водорода из кофейной гущи
Не будет преувеличением, если сказать, что фактически у каждого в аптечке есть перекись водорода. Любой порез или царапина часто следовали одной и той же схеме обработки: перекись, зеленка, пластырь. Кто в детстве любил и умел находить приключения на одно место,…
-
Диаграмма эффектов: пример построения
Следить за обновлениями блога можно в моём канале: Эргономичный кодЭто второй пост в серии, посвящённый диаграмме эффектов:»Спецификация» — назначение диаграммы, основные концептуальные элементы и их визуальное представление.»Пример построения, проект True Story Project (TSP)» — процесс построения диаграммы эффектов реального проекта.»Декомпозиция…
-
Инструменты CI/CD: GitLab CI
На рынке доступно множество инструментов непрерывной интеграции и непрерывного развёртывания. Эти инструменты играют ведущую роль в координации и автоматизации работы на различных этапах CI/CD-пайплайна.Мы пообщались с Александром Довнаром, Lead DevOps в Naviteq, и узнали, как безопасность проекта связана с выбором…
-
Пасхалки в ПО
Пасхальные яйца в ПО стары так же, как и само программное обеспечение. Первый сюрприз от разработчиков нашли в компьютерной игре Adventure, вышедшей в 1979 году. Но сегодня мы хотим поговорить о более современных пасхалках, известных и не очень.Tesla Model X Многие…
-
Рефакторинг приложения с десятилетним легаси за три месяца. Опыт Яндекс Музыки
Однажды ты просыпаешься и понимаешь: избыточность компонентов и рассинхронизация в твоём приложении начинают вредить пользователям. Однажды ты смотришь на написанное давным-давно ядро, плачешь горькими слезами, и приходит это некомфортное, но вместе с тем немного соблазнительное ощущение — что рефакторинг назрел.…
-
Автоматизация задач в интернете. 30 лет прогресса — и к чему мы пришли?
Грустно наблюдать человека, который ежедневно повторяет одну и ту же работу. Буквально совершенно одинаковые действия, вручную. Особенно если этот человек — ты сам. Так и хочется автоматизировать задачу, а в свободное время заняться… чем? Не проблема, мы всегда найдём чем…
-
Лайфхак по разработке DMR на ПЛИС через генерацию HDL-кода в MATLAB
Однажды мне прилетела задача реализовать DMR на ПЛИС. Опустившись на дно интернета, я нашел лишь мануал ETSI и пару примеров по генерации кода – с этого начался мой тернистый путь изучения данной тематики. Недавно наткнулся на мем, и тут нахлынули…
-
SIEM-SIEM, откройся: какие инструменты наиболее эффективно анализируют цифровую инфраструктуру
Волна кибератак нарастает, две трети из них совершаются с целью получения данных. Как найти белые пятна в средствах защиты информации (СЗИ) и навести порядок в инфраструктуре, как помогает в решении этих задач Security Information and Event Management (SIEM), раскрыл руководитель…